    Nesting Success of American Robins (Turdus Migratorius) in Suburban Areas of the Arkansas River Valley

    The American Robin (Turdus migratorius) is an abundant North American songbird species that thrives in suburban areas. Estimates of robin nesting success in suburban areas range from 31% to 90%. Robin nest site selection and success have not received much attention in the past few decades. Most passerines have a balanced sex ratio at fledging, but little is known about the fledgling sex ratio of robins. We located 44 robin nests in six public parks around Russellville, AR and on the Arkansas Tech University campus. Nest success was low; 27% (12/44) of nests fledged at least one young. Robins nested most frequently in American Sweetgum (Liquidambar styraciflua), Crape Myrtle (Lagerstroemia indica), Pin Oak (Quercus palustris), and Willow Oak (Quercus phellos), but were also found nesting on buildings early in the breeding season. An average nest was approximately 5 m off the ground and was 66% concealed by vegetation. Fledglings survived for an average of twelve days and half of the fledglings (7/14) survived for less than seven days. Low fledgling survival in combination with low nesting success suggests that robin productivity was low in 2022. Environmental stressors like drought can lead to shifts in avian sex ratios. The sex ratio of fledgling robins we banded was skewed towards females (15:7). Further study is required to determine what characteristics of the suburban environment may lead to low reproductive success for robins, and how robins deal with the challenges of breeding in poor-quality habitat

    Corporate Governance and Choice of Capital Structure

    In this paper, we expand on the existing literature of corporate finance by analyzing the impact of corporate governance on the choice of capital structure for firms. Although other studies have analyzed this relationship, we extend the research by comparing the results across different industries such as healthcare, technology, consumer goods and industrial goods using a sample of 689 firms. The results show the relationship of corporate governance to the choice of capital is negative in the healthcare sector firms, positive in the consumer goods firms, and has no impact on technology or industrial goods firms

    P-ring: The Conserved Nature of Phosphorus Enriched Cells in Seedling Roots of Distantly Related Species

    Plants require sunlight, carbon dioxide, water and mineral ions for their growth and development. Roots in vascular plants sequester water and ions from soil and transport them to the aboveground parts of the plant. Due to heterogeneous nature of soil, roots have evolved several regulatory barriers from molecular to organismic level that selectively allows certain ions to enter the vascular tissues for transport according to the physiological and metabolic demands of plant cell. Current literature profusely elaborates about apoplastic barriers, but the possibility of the existence of a symplastic regulation through phosphorous-enriched cells has not been mentioned. Recent investigations on native ion distribution in seedling roots of several species (Pinus pinea, Zea mays and Arachis hypogaea) identified an ionomic structure termed as “P-ring”. The P-ring is composed of a group of phosphorous-rich cells arranged in radial symmetry encircling the vascular tissues. Physiological investigations indicate that the structure is relatively inert to external temperature and ion fluctuations while anatomical studies indicates that they are less likely to be apoplastic in nature. Furthermore, their localization surrounding vascular tissues and in evolutionarily distinct plant lineages might indicate their conserved nature and involvement in ion regulation. Undoubtedly, this is an interesting and important observation that has significant merit for further investigations by the plant science community

    Examining ESL Preservice Teachers’ Personal Factors That Best Predict Their Confidence to Integrate Technology in Future Classrooms

    This study was designed to examine preservice teachers\u27 personal characteristics that can predict their confidence to integrate technology in their teaching practices. The investigators used a questionnaire designed based on Bandura’s Social Cognitive Theory to ask 168 ESL preservice teachers enrolled in the English Department in a public university located in central Anatolia. The results of this study found that the use of technology during ESL preservice teachers\u27 training was the most significant predictor of their self-efficacy to integrate technology in their teaching practices, then followed by the number of years they are attending the education training and finally their learning preferences such as the use of multimedia and digital materials. The results of this study also found that ESL preservice teachers’ gender and age were insignificant causes for building their confidence to integrate technology. The study also has found that there is a significant relationship between ESL preservice teachers\u27 use of technology and their levels of self-efficacy and this relationship was strong and positive. These findings indicate that prior experience with technology among preservice teachers is a key component in determining their confidence in integrating technology into teaching and learning. The study offers vital insights into how teacher education programs might effectively prepare ESL preservice teachers for technology integration. Teacher education programs should prioritize chances for preservice teachers to obtain practical experience using technology in classroom settings. Finally, the investigators provide interpretation and recommendations based on these findings

    Emotional Responses to COVID-19 Stressors Increase Information Avoidance About an Important Unrelated Health Threat

    The COVID-19 pandemic, like other crises, has had direct and indirect impacts on individuals, many of which have been negative. While a large body of research has examined the impacts of COVID-19 on people\u27s lives, there is little evidence about how COVID-19 affects decision-making broadly. Emotional responses to COVID-19-related stressors, such as illness and income loss, provide a pathway for these stressors to affect decision-making. In this study, we examine linkages between exposure to COVID-19-related stressors—focusing on temporally specific local case counts and loss of income due to the pandemic—and decisions to access information about antimicrobial resistance (AMR), another critically important health issue.     Student Willingness to Report Weapons and School Violence at a Rural Secondary School in Arkansas: A Quantitative Study

    School safety continues to be a concerning and vital topic in education. This quantitative study examines the willingness of students from a rural Arkansas school district to report weapons being brought to school or violent occurrences happening at school and analyzes the behavior associated with students reporting or not reporting. The study examines barriers that exist to help to explain why students would not report weapons or violent incidents to staff members or adults in the school district. The study surveyed 52 students from a secondary school with Likert-style survey questions. The questions were grouped into different variables such as demographics, academic success, relationship to the perpetrator, reporting frequencies, and knowledge of available school resources. This allowed the researcher to analyze any data trends from students who were willing to report violent occurrences or weapons being brought to school versus those who would not. The relationship between the victim/perpetrator and the potential reporting student was a statistically significant indicator of reporting behaviors. The fear of retaliation was also a statistically significant variable in students’ willingness to report. Lastly, the knowledge of available resources at school to report and whom to report to was statistically significant in comparing the groups of students who were willing to report versus those who were not. The findings of this study allow the school district to revisit or implement its school safety plans and procedures to add emphasis to educating students and staff about the importance of reporting. A suggested recommendation from the findings would also be to increase reporting methods and opportunities for students and to have continuous education on how to report within the school

    Distracted Driving Detection System

    In 2020, distracted driving claimed 3,142 lives in the United States[1]. Using current technology, our project aims to prototype a device that uses computer vision to crack down on this dangerous behavior while working with insurance agencies that provide incentives for customers to adopt the device. At the heart of this project is a deep learning algorithm trained to classify images on a set of 10 classes: safe driving, texting - right, talking on the phone - right, texting - left, talking on the phone - left, operating the radio, drinking, reaching behind, hair and makeup, and talking to passenger. This algorithm is deployed onto a microcontroller, which is mounted above the passenger side window with a connected camera and power supply, taking images like the one shown above. In short, the algorithm classifies periodically taken images and determines the motorist’s safe-driving performance. The driver\u27s performance is then sent to the insurance company through a mobile application. From there, the insurance company will adjust the user’s insurance rate based on their safe driving performance. Thus, an incentive for drivers is made to adopt the product and practice safe driving more thoroughly

    Antibacterial properties of Devil’s Walking Stick and Winged Sumac extracts

    Many native plants are used for the treatment of various diseases. Mainly those species in high chemical compound plant families can have antimicrobial properties. We selected two native plants in Arkansas, Devil’s walking stick (Aralia spinosa), and Winged sumac (Rhus copallinum), and tested them for antibacterial properties. We used three gram-positive bacteria (Bacillus cereus, Bacillus subtilis, and Staphylococcus epidermidis) and three gram-negative bacteria (Alcaligenes faecalis, Escherichia coli, and Serratia marcescens). The disc diffusion method is employed to identify any potential antibacterial properties for the two plant species. For this experiment, 6.50 g of dehydrated plant material (leaves of each plant species) was combined with 50 mL of 75% ethanol creating their respective tinctures which were processed to remove alcohol and make power samples. The antibacterial activity of the powders in sterile Milli-Q water was tested against 75% ethanol and hydrogen peroxide controls. After 24 and 48 hours of incubation at 37°C, the zones of inhibition were measured for each bacteria/plant sample combination. The plant samples were tested for inhibition of each bacterial species. We used nested ANOVA (analysis of variance) to examine the effect of different concentrations of plant samples and two different incubation times (24h and 48h) of each plant species on zones of inhibition for six different bacteria. Preliminary investigations showed antibacterial properties in the samples. This indicates that native plant species can have potential medicinal properties

    A Phenomenological Examination of the Lived Experiences of African American Female Superintendents in the State of Arkansas

    Abstract The purpose of this qualitative study was to examine the lived experiences of African American female Superintendents in the State of Arkansas. One of the major educational issues is the limited number of African American female superintendents in the USA and the state of Arkansas, in particular. African American women venturing into the superintendency are hindered in their goals by their double minority status as women and African Americans (Wiley et al., 2017). A qualitative, narrative research lens was used in this study to capture the individual career advancement of African American female Superintendents in the State of Arkansas. Data collection centered on personal, one-on-one interviews with African American female Superintendents in the State of Arkansas. The primary and guiding research questions for this study were focused on the women backgrounds, experiences, and educational paths that led to their superintendent position. A series of common themes emerged from the interviews and produced a clear understanding of the path the female superintendents traveled to assume the most important decision-making role in their respective school districts. Key themes which emerged were leadership ability, leadership desire, and mentorship. Participants indicated they had developed a keen sense of self-efficacy, which led to broader goals and career advancements. In future research, it is important to analyze opportunities women have which help shape, encourage, and support other African American women moving into the role of Superintendent in the State of Arkansas.
